    Default Re: Calcium

    Extra calcium isnt needed if the diet is correct, and if it's not correct, you'll end up having problems that calcium alone can't solve. Can you tell us what the diet is, exactly?

    Though he needs vitamin D (which he should get from his diet) too much can be lethal, so we generally recommend not giving it as a supplement.
